Mr Einar Gervasius Karlsson
Mr Einar Gervasius Karlsson, 21, was born on 19 June, 1890. He came from Oscarshamn, Småland, Sweden. He boarded the Titanic at Southampton, he was travelling to 449 bergen St. Brooklyn, New York.
Einar Karlsson had earlier been a professional soldier but had decided to emigrate, he got an emigration certificate on 27 March. He travelled with Johan Charles Asplund. According Karlsson's own acount he jumped into the water and was picked up by a boat, but most likely he just stepped into lifeboat 13 as very few non-crew members were ever picked up. He also told that he fell to sleep in the boat and woke only when the boat reached the Carpathia.
Karlsson later recieved $25 from the Salvation Army Fund in New York.

Summary
Born: Thursday 19th June 1890
Age: 21 years
Last Residence: in Oskarshamn Småland Sweden
Occupation: Military
3rd Class passenger
First Embarked: Southampton on Wednesday 10th April 1912
Ticket No. 350053 , £7 15s 11d
Destination: Brooklyn New York United States
Rescued (boat 13)
Disembarked Carpathia: New York City on Thursday 18th April 1912
Died: Saturday 12th April 1958
